DCSF: Children Accommodated in Secure Children's Homes at 31 March 2009: England and Wales

DescriptionThis SFR gives statistics on children accommodated in secure children's homes at 31 March 2009 and includes data from England and Wales. The SFR includes information on places approved, and children accommodated by sex, age, length of stay and type of placement.

The latest statistics update those previously released on 24 July 2008.

The key points from this release are:
  • 290 children were accommodated in secure children's homes in England and Wales at 31 March 2009 - 275 in England and 15 in Wales. This represents a rise of 4 per cent on the 2008 total of 280.
  • The number of secure children's homes, open at 31 March 2009 in England and Wales, is 19, the same number as in 2008.
  • At 31 March 2009, there were 340 approved places in these 19 secure children's homes open in England and Wales.
  • 86 per cent of approved places were occupied. This represents an increase from 2008 when the occupancy rate was 81 per cent.
